Abstract
A method and apparatus to create a more favorable flow regime in a lumen. An artificial shape in the lumen is created to at least one of eliminate flow disturbances and enchance aspects of fluid flow through a treatment site.

61 . A stent for implantation in a lumen of a blood vessel, having a non-uniform shape of its envelope upon expansion, where the stent comprises:
a first and a second stent segments extending in the circumferential direction of the stent and being longitudinally offset with respect to each other; a third stent segment configured to assume a tapered configuration in an expanded state of the stent; a fourth stent segment connecting the first stent segment to the third stent segment; a fifth stent segment connecting the third stent segment to the second stent segment; wherein the fourth and fifth stent segments are configured to assume a tapered configuration in an expanded state of the stent and have diverging configurations.
62 . The stent of claim 61 , wherein said stent is a self-expanding stent.
63 . The stent of claim 61 , wherein first and second stent segments are provided with different cross-sectional areas as compared to one another.
64 . The stent of claim 61 , wherein the first, second and third stent segments are configured such that, in an expanded state thereof, the stent is frustoconical.
65 . The stent of claim 61 , wherein first and second stent segments are provided with the same cross-sectional areas as compared to one another.
66 . The stent of claim 61 , wherein said stent is a balloon-expandable stent and configured to be expanded by a delivery balloon to be asymmetrical with respect to the longitudinal axis of said stent.
